NCT ID: NCT05303194 Active, not recruiting - Dementia Clinical Trials

Patient Priorities Care for Hispanics With Dementia

PPC-HD
Start date: May 31, 2022
Phase: N/A
Study type: Interventional

Most persons living with dementia (PlwD) have multiple chronic conditions (MCC). Managing MCC typically involves adhering to clinical practice guidelines for single diseases. This approach often results in burdensome care that usually does not reflect what matters most to patients. To address the challenges of caring for patients with MCC, Patient Priorities Care (PPC) was developed - a process that aligns treatment recommendations with patient priorities rather than single-disease guidelines, to improve care. Successful completion of this pragmatic pilot project will help determine how to best embedded PPC in a Healthcare system that serves a large Hispanic population. The investigators will determine if the benefits previously reported with the use of PPC hold in Hispanics with dementia.

NCT ID: NCT05282654 Recruiting - Adverse Event Clinical Trials

Real-time Symptom Monitoring Using ePROs to Prevent Adverse Events During Care Transitions

Start date: February 1, 2022
Phase: N/A
Study type: Interventional

This study aims to predict and minimize post-discharge adverse events (AEs) during care transitions through early identification and escalation of patient-reported symptoms to inpatient and ambulatory clinicians by way of predictive algorithms and clinically integrated digital health apps. We will (1) develop and prospectively validate a predictive model of post-discharge AEs for patients with multiple chronic conditions (MCC); (2) combine, adapt, extend, and iteratively refine our EHR-integrated digital health infrastructure in a series of design sessions with patient and clinician participants; (3) conduct a RCT to evaluate the impact of ePRO monitoring on post-discharge AEs for MCC patients discharged from the general medicine service across Brigham Health; and (4) use mixed methods to evaluate barriers and facilitators of implementation and use as we develop a plan for sustainability, scale, and dissemination.

NCT ID: NCT05264207 Completed - Chronic Disease Clinical Trials

Nursing Students' Visits to Older Adults With Multiple Chronic Conditions

VISITAME
Start date: March 15, 2022
Phase: N/A
Study type: Interventional

BACKGROUND The concurrence of multiple chronic conditions in older adults is associated with increased healthcare expenditure, increased hospital admissions, consultations and pharmaceutical expenditure. Having been diagnosed with multiple chronic conditions is associated with biopsychosocial health deterioration, worsening quality of life and increased mortality in older adults. Consequently, older adults with multiple chronic conditions present complex health statuses that require healthcare professional to focus on promoting health and independence through self-care. Available evidence suggests that the implementation of programs with individualized interventions focused on health promotion could improve self-care and other related variables in older people with chronic conditions. In this regard, the World Health Organization recommends the implementation of community health promotion programs including at least 5 home-visits carried out by healthcare professionals to promote self-care, independence, and quality of life amongst older adults with chronic conditions. However, the evidence on the cost-effectiveness of such visiting programs is inconsistent, which makes it difficult to integrate them into the services offered by public-funded healthcare systems. In search of more effective interventions to improve self-care and other related variables amongst older adults with multiple chronic conditions, nursing student visits could be a valid, effective alternative. Some studies suggest that the implementation of periodic follow-up programs (visits or telephone calls) by nursing students not only improves their knowledge and attitudes in relation to the care of older adults, but they could also have a positive impact on patients. STUDY'S HYPOTHESIS A program of supervised visits carried out by nursing students will significantly improve self-care behaviors and other related variables amongst older adults with multiple chronic conditions. AIM The aim of the VISITAME project is to examine the short-term (12 weeks) and medium-term (6 months) effects of a nursing students' home-visit programme on self-care behaviors amongst older adults with multiple chronic conditions. STUDY DESIGN A parallel two-arm randomized controlled trial (RCT) will be carried out. Participants will be randomly assigned to either an intervention group (IG) or a control group (CG).

NCT ID: NCT05240534 Active, not recruiting - Clinical trials for Chronic Conditions, Multiple

ElderTree Via a Voice Activated Device for Managing Chronic Health Conditions (NHLBI)

Start date: April 29, 2022
Phase: N/A
Study type: Interventional

Multiple chronic conditions (MCCs) are costly and pervasive among older adults. MCCs account for 90% of Medicare spending, and 65% of Medicare beneficiaries have 3 or more chronic conditions; 23% have 5 or more. MCCs are often addressed in primary care, where time pressures force a focus on medication and lab results rather than self-management skills. Patients often struggle with treatment adherence and the emotional and physical burdens of self-management and health tracking. Chronic conditions reduce quality of life (QOL) and increase loneliness, which exacerbate those conditions. The primary purpose of this study is to investigate whether a voice-based platform is better for delivering an electronic health intervention to older adults than a text/typing-based platform. We have an evidence-based electronic health intervention (Elder Tree, ET) that has been shown to improve quality of life, physical and socio-emotional health outcomes for older adults with multiple chronic conditions when delivered via a text/typing-based system. The current project would test whether such patients would benefit even more if ET were delivered via a voice-based system (vs. the text-based system) because they would use it more consistently. ET is an existing intervention providing tools, motivation, and support on a computer platform to help older adults manage their health.

NCT ID: NCT05156073 Completed - Dementia Clinical Trials

Shared Decision Making About Medication Use for People With Multiple Health Problems

Start date: May 22, 2023
Phase: N/A
Study type: Interventional

The Shared Decision Making about Medication Use for People with Multiple Health Problems study will assess the feasibility and acceptability of a deprescribing educational intervention in primary care for patients with mild cognitive impairment or dementia and/or multiple chronic conditions (MCC), the patients' care partners, clinicians, and medical assistants. The intervention consists of the following strategies: 1) a patient/caregiver component focused on education and activation about deprescribing, and 2) a clinician component focused on increasing clinician awareness about options and processes for deprescribing in the MCI/dementia and/or MCC population. Clinicians will each be asked to participate in a single, 15-minute educational session on deprescribing, and medical residents will receive a 45-minute lecture. Patients, caregivers, clinicians, and medical assistants will participate in a single one-on-one debriefing interview.

NCT ID: NCT05129709 Recruiting - Family Members Clinical Trials

Black Health Identification Program (B-HIP)

Start date: February 1, 2022
Phase: N/A
Study type: Interventional

Nearly 69% of African American (AA) Medicare beneficiaries have multiple chronic conditions (MCCs) such as cancer and cardiopulmonary diseases. Older age and MCCs are guideline-recommended indications for referral to early palliative care to assist with effective communication and value-solicitation surrounding treatment decision-making. Studies have shown that early palliative care participation achieves beneficial goals of care communication, quality of life (QOL), symptom burden, and mood in older adults with cancer and heart failure as well as among their family caregivers. However, older AAs with MCCs, especially those living in the Deep South, are less likely to have access to early palliative care, even though they generally experience higher symptom burden, healthcare use, and poorer communication around goals of care. This disparity in palliative care use may be, in part, to a lack of culturally-responsive care practices that effectively activate AAs with MCCs to identify their own values and priorities for end-of-life care. While efficacious communication models exist, few have been tested in culturally-diverse samples. Guided by the theory of Social Cognitive Theory and Health Behavior Model, this study's purpose is to conduct a formative evaluation of a Self-directed "My Health Priorities" Identification Program to determine cultural acceptability and feasibility of use in among AAs with MCCs in a primary care setting. The 2-phase study specific aims are to: Aim 1. (Phase 1) Conduct a single-arm formative evaluation trial of Self-directed "My Health Priorities" Identification Program to determine acceptability and feasibility with a sample of 20 AA patients with MCCs and FCGs and adapt for future efficacy testing. Aim 2. (Phase 2) To examine the ability of the dyads to complete pre- and post-test measures of perception of care, treatment burden, shared decision-making, and communication exchange. The findings from the research will directly inform a small-scale pilot grant that will assess acceptability, feasibility, and potential efficacy of a values solicitation and operationalization intervention for AAs with MCCs and caregivers.

NCT ID: NCT05075902 Suspended - Hypertension Clinical Trials

Effect of Aerobic Training on the Health Parameters of Postmenopausal Women With Multimorbidity

Start date: February 1, 2019
Phase: N/A
Study type: Interventional

People affected by multiple chronic diseases have a greater chance of hospitalization, longer hospital stays, worse general health, worse physical and mental function and lower functional capacity, with an average risk of 50% of functional decline with each additional condition. The frequency of multimorbidity is higher in older, inactive women, who live in urban areas in low- and middle-income countries, the most affected by multimorbidity. The practice of physical exercise is an important component in the prevention of multiple chronic diseases, in which lower levels of physical activity were associated with an increased prevalence of multimorbidity in women aged 16 to 24 years. And regardless of the presence of multimorbidity, engaging in a healthier lifestyle, including regular physical activity, was associated with up to 7.6 more years of life for women, improving the individual's general health status even when multimorbid. The hypothesis is that multimorbid women have a worse general health status when compared to women without multimorbidity, but aerobic exercise will be able to improve health parameters in 12 weeks of training. This is a quasi-experimental clinical trial with a 12-week aerobic training intervention in postmenopausal women with and without cardiometabolic multimorbidity. Participants were allocated into groups according to the amount of cardiometabolic diseases, with the Morbidity group (MORB) being composed of women with one or no chronic cardiometabolic disease and the Multimorbidity group (MULTI) with two or more chronic cardiometabolic diseases. The assessments of arterial stiffness, 24-hour ambulatory pressure, blood pressure variability, heart rate variability, lipid and glucose profile, body composition and climacteric symptoms were performed before and after the training period. The study was carried out at the Laboratory of Cardiorespiratory and Metabolic Physiology at the Faculty of Physical Education of the Federal University of Uberlândia, Uberlândia, Brazil and approved by the Ethics Committee for studies in humans (CAEE: 12453719.1.0000.5152). All participants signed a consent form. The experiments followed the principles of the Declaration of Helsinki. The program consists of aerobic physical exercises performed three times a week on non-consecutive days for 12 weeks with an intensity of 65% to 75% of the reserve heart rate.
